| Typical costs: | - Fees average $5,413 but can go up to $7,625 for straightening your teeth with traditional braces (orthodontics), according to BracesInfo.com. Add about $500 for "tooth colored" ceramic brackets; and behind-the-teeth (called lingual or concealed) braces are an additional $2,000-$5,000.
- As an alternative, the Invisalign company says its clear plastic trays start at $3,500 and average around $5,000 nationwide, but can cost more. Most dental plans cover orthodontics for children up to age 18, but not for adults.
What should be included: | - Modern braces are smaller and more comfortable than past "railroad tracks." A metal or ceramic bracket is attached to each tooth with glue or a metal band; an arch wire runs from bracket to bracket, putting pressure on the teeth to move in the desired direction; and small colored elastics hold the bracket on the arch wire, although some brackets don't need elastics. According to ArchWired.com, metal braces tend to require the least amount of time to move your teeth, but are the most visible; ceramic braces are less visible, but treatment can take a few months longer and they aren't strong enough to correct severe bite problems.
- Invisible outside your mouth, iBraces use metal brackets installed only on the tongue side of your teeth. They require specialized training to install, treatment can take a few months longer and they might not work for severe situations.
- Instead of brackets and wires, Invisalign uses computer-fabricated clear plastic "aligner" trays; you switch to a new (numbered) aligner every two weeks. Invisalign isn't good for severe bite problems and some patients may still need traditional braces for a few months. Additional costs: | - You can have your brackets gold-plated for a jewelry-type look; in bright colors such as purple, pink, green or black; or shaped like hearts, flowers, footballs or other images from Wild Smiles Brackets. View some of the possibilities at Thinkquest.org. And Bracket Jacketz offers inexpensive plastic covers in a wide range of shapes, including letters and symbols. These options can add $5-$300 or more to the total cost.
Discounts: | - For dental college clinics offering reduced rates for services by supervised students or faculty, visit DentalSite.com.
- Dental societies may pay part of the costs for low-income patients; visit the American Dental Association for your state organization.
